Intel X25-V Solid State Drive

Intel has started its new X25-V Solid State Drive shipment to US and Europe stores. Available in 40GB capacity and comes with MLC NAND Flash memory chips, a SATA 3.0 Gbps interface, a MTBF of 1.2 million hours and the read/write speed at 170MB/s and 35MB/s respectively. WD My Book 3.0

The WD My Book 3.0 is an external drive that is going to be faster than your current external drive. It uses USB 3.0 interface which is faster than USB 2.0 ten times, with transfer rates of up to five gigabits-per-second. Ritek Ridata 600X CF Card

Ritek USA is going to shoot out its new line of CF cards, the Ridata 600X series. Comes in 4GB, 8GB and 16GB, support CIS implementation with 256 bytes of attribute and provide read speed up to 94MB/s and write speed of 92MB/s.

In addition, they also have a MTBF of 1 million hours and feature built-in Error Correction Code (ECC) to detect and correct errors automatically.

Clickfree Traveler

Clickfree has released its new external SSD which measures about the size of a credit card. Available in 16GB, 32GB and 64GB capacities which priced at $79.99, $149.99 and $249.99, respectively.

The Clickfree Traveler offers incremental backup; upon first connection it will automatically find all of the user data files and copy them to the hard drive. Each time after that, it will only back up the new files or the ones that have changed.
